Equilibrium Definitions
1 of 2) Equilibrium : توازن : (noun) a stable situation in which forces cancel one another.
2 of 2) Equilibrium, Balance, Counterbalance, Equipoise : توازن سے دینا, برابر تقسیم : (noun) equality of distribution.
